Help! - Old Nursing Journals

Does anyone know where to find old nursing journals? I'm looking for journals from the 50s, 60s, 70s, and 80s, but my library recently discarded the physical ones and replaced them with digital versions. I'm looking at how nursing journals have changed over time, so I need physical copies in order to do this. Does anyone know where I could get a big stack of old nursing journals? There must be people with stacks of these in their attics somewhere.

Re: Old Nursing Journals

If you want to look at several, you will probably need to go to a health sciences library at a school. If your school no longer keeps old issues, then you'll probably have to try other (perhaps larger) libraries who maintain lots a large collection of resources. For example a large university with a medical school as well as a nursing school that has a big research library.
